Paul Davis Speaking to M3s

The M3s will have a special presentation from Paul Davis on February 26 in period 2.

Period 2 teachers have been contacted, but all M3 teachers are strongly encouraged to attend if available to hear what the M3s are learning about digital citizenship and cyber safety. Below is Paul’s bio:

Paul Davis has dedicated his 30-year career to IT/Cyber safety. Since his first presentation over ten years ago, he has spoken to over 620,000 students in four provinces and five states, along with the Ontario Provincial Police, Canada Border Services and the Department of National Defence. He provides a fact-based delivery on how parents/guardians and children may use technology safely, without falling into the pitfalls that can be associated with the internet and associated electronic communications.


Congratulations Carole

Congratulations to Carole Zamroutian, Associate Director, Advancement, on receiving the 2024 McMillan-Edwards Award from ISAP Canada (Independent Schools Advancement Professionals)!

This national award for Advancement staff honours those who perform beyond the call of duty and significantly contribute to our school’s success in Advancement.
